
Ocala, United States – January 21, 2026 – As a rising star in the noble sport, Charlotte Jacobs (USA) has shown she’s a force to be reckoned with at high-level competitions the past 3-4 years and that was the case on the opening day of CSI 4* classes at World Equestrian Center (WEC) – Ocala this year.

Riding Thomascourt Ballypatrick, the North Star Sport Horse’s 11-year-old bay Irish Sport Horse gelding (Balou du Rouet x Indoctro), she blew past the competition to win the $32,000 Speed Challenge CSI 4*, clearing all the 1.45m obstacles before crossing the finish line in 66.49 seconds.

Sergio Álvarez Moya (ESP) and Be Blue were the closest ones, finishing second only due to their time of 68.75 seconds.
Paul O’Shea (IRL) and Manglar LS La Silla rounded out the top three, registering no penalties in 71.40 seconds.

Final Results – $32,000 Speed Challenge CSI 4* – 1.45m
1) Charlotte Jacobs (USA) & Thomascourt Ballypatrick – 0 – 66.49
2) Sergio Álvarez Moya (ESP) & Be Blue – 0 – 68.75
3) Paul O’Shea (IRL) & Manglar LS La Silla – 0 – 71.40
